A 2-wheel motorcycle failing the inspection will not affect the renewal of a C1 license, as long as there are no unresolved traffic violations or unpaid fines, etc., which would otherwise hinder the renewal of the driver's license. The C1 driver's license is one of the classifications for motor vehicle driving licenses. The C1 license permits driving small and micro passenger vehicles, as well as light and micro cargo vehicles, and light, small, and micro special-purpose vehicles, covering all models under C2, C3, and C4 classifications. Renewal period for a C1 driver's license: The initial C1 driver's license is valid for 6 years. Within 90 days before the expiration date, the license holder must undergo the renewal and inspection process to ensure the license can be legally and normally used in the next validity period. Documents required for C1 driver's license renewal: A duly completed 'Motor Vehicle Driver's License Application Form,' the original 'Motor Vehicle Driver Physical Condition Certificate' issued by a county-level or above medical institution designated by the Municipal Health Bureau, the original and a copy of the applicant's identity proof (if applying through an agent, the original and a copy of the agent's identity proof must also be submitted; local temporary residents must additionally submit residence or temporary residence certificates issued by the public security authority besides their ID card), the original motor vehicle driver's license, and 3 photos of the driver.

What should be paid attention to when driving in windy weather for Subject 4?

When driving in strong winds, attention should be paid to uncertain targets, and windows should be rolled up tightly during driving. Extended information is as follows: 1. Pay attention to unstable targets: such as pedestrians, bicycles, and livestock to prevent them from rushing into the motor lane. Try to drive at medium to low speeds. When encountering uncertain targets, honk the horn promptly. The effect of the horn may be weakened by the strong wind, so be prepared to brake and stop at any time. 2. Roll up the windows tightly: to prevent dust from flying in and affecting the driver's breathing and observation. Avoid dead trees and dangerous walls, and stay away from trucks loaded with goods to prevent injury from scattered items.

Will replacing the rear windshield film damage the heating strips?

The replacement of rear windshield film may damage the heating strips. Here is relevant information about heating strips: 1. Function: The heating wires are similar to resistance wires. Their purpose is to defrost or defog the glass during rainy, snowy, or foggy weather. When the driver turns on the defrost/fog control switch, the resistance wires heat up upon electrification, raising the glass temperature. The frost or fog attached to the glass melts into water droplets that flow down or evaporate as mist, thereby achieving the defrosting and defogging effect, allowing drivers to clearly discern rear traffic conditions and perform safe operations like reversing. 2. Consequences: Improper handling during the film removal process can easily cause the heating wires to break, resulting in the loss of the rear window defogging function. When heating wires break, they cannot be repaired, and the only solution is to replace the entire glass.

What are the test contents for an automatic transmission driver's license?

The test contents for an automatic transmission driver's license are as follows: 1. Subject 1: Road traffic rules, traffic signals, handling of traffic safety violations and accidents, regulations on the application and use of motor vehicle driver's licenses, motor vehicle registration, and other road traffic safety laws, regulations, and rules. 2. Subject 2: Reversing into a parking space, stopping and starting on a slope, parallel parking, curve driving, and right-angle turns. 3. Subject 3: Test preparations before driving, starting, driving straight, gear shifting operations, changing lanes, pulling over, going straight through intersections, turning left at intersections, turning right at intersections, passing through pedestrian crossings, passing through school zones, passing through bus stops, meeting oncoming vehicles, overtaking, making U-turns, and nighttime driving.

Is it necessary to replace the rear oxygen sensor?

The replacement of the rear oxygen sensor depends on the situation. If it is severely damaged, it is recommended to replace it promptly. Below is relevant information about oxygen sensors: 1. Principle: The oxygen sensor is a standard configuration in cars. It uses ceramic sensitive elements to measure the oxygen potential in the vehicle's exhaust pipe and calculates the corresponding oxygen concentration based on the chemical equilibrium principle, thereby monitoring and controlling the combustion air-fuel ratio to ensure product quality and compliance with exhaust emission standards. 2. Advantages: Oxygen sensors are widely used in the atmosphere control of various coal, oil, and gas combustion furnaces. They represent the best current method for measuring combustion atmosphere, offering advantages such as simple structure, rapid response, easy maintenance, convenient use, and accurate measurement.
